#### Troubleshooting
|
||||
|
||||
| Problem | Solution |
|
||||
|---------|----------|
|
||||
| `ModuleNotFoundError: No module named 'cupy'` | Install cupy using the steps above |
|
||||
| `cupy` installed but `ImportError` at runtime | CUDA version mismatch — uninstall with `pip uninstall cupy-cuda12x` and reinstall the correct version |
|
||||
| Install hangs or takes very long | cupy wheels are large (~800MB). Use a fast connection and be patient |
|
||||
| Docker / no build tools | Use the prebuilt wheel: `pip install cupy-cuda12x` (not `cupy` which compiles from source) |

#### Can I skip cupy?
|
||||
|
||||
Yes — just use **EMA-VFI**, which does not require cupy. It is the fastest model and uses the least VRAM. The other three models (BIM-VFI, SGM-VFI, GIMM-VFI) will not load without cupy.
